- 博客(16)
- 资源 (3)
- 收藏
- 关注
翻译 Akka QuickStart with java项目中文翻译(一)
下载示例文件Hello World实例文件所运行的前置条件:Java8和Maven下载实例文件可以通过示例官网Lightbend Tech Hubquot通过点击 CREATE A PROGECT FOR ME获取项目压缩文件。解压缩文件通过IDEA导入即可。运行实例通过运行AkkaQuickstart.java中的Main方法,控制台即会输出如下结果:[INFO] ...
2018-05-22 11:10:17
865
翻译 RabbitMQ 基础教程 Topics(按照主题分发消息)
在上篇Routing(消息路由)文章中,我们实现了一个简单的日志系统。Consumer可以监听不同severity的log。但是,这也是它之所以叫做简单日志系统的原因,因为是仅仅能够通过severity设定。不支持更多的标准。比如syslog unix的日志工具,它可以通过severity (info/warn/crit…) 和模块(auth/cron/kern…)。这可能更是我们想要的:我们可以仅
2017-08-05 10:36:09
554
翻译 RabbitMQ 基础教程 Routing(消息路由)
上篇文章中,我们构建了一个简单的日志系统。接下来,我们将丰富它:能够使用不同的severity来监听不同等级的log。比如我们希望只有error的log才保存到磁盘上。一、Bindings(绑定)上篇文章中我们是这么做的绑定:channel.queueBind(queueName, EXCHANGE_NAME, "");绑定其实就是关联了exchange和queue。或者这么说:queue对exch
2017-08-05 10:29:52
485
翻译 RabbitMQ 基础教程 Publish/Subscribe(发布/订阅)
上篇文章中,我们把每个Message都是deliver到某个Consumer。在这篇文章中,我们将会将同一个Message deliver到多个Consumer中。这个模式也被成为 “publish / subscribe”。这篇文章中,我们将创建一个日志系统,它包含两个部分:第一个部分是发出log(Producer),第二个部分接收到并打印(Consumer)。 我们将构建两个Consumer,第
2017-08-04 16:43:46
1167
原创 Spring MVC 基础教程
1. 创建一个简单的maven项目2. 修改pom.xml文件<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://
2017-05-11 17:21:50
202
翻译 RabbitMQ 基础教程 Hello World
本节我们将参照官网给出的Hello World示例,构建一个发送接收消息的入门小程序创建一个simple的Maven工程 在pom.xml中添加<dependencies> <dependency> <groupId>com.rabbitmq</groupId> <artifactId>amqp-client</artifactId> <v
2017-04-26 16:34:13
366
原创 使用java validation校验不起作用的解决方法
依赖的jar包没有完整导入<dependency> <groupId>javax.validation</groupId> <artifactId>validation-api</artifactId> <version>1.1.0.Final</version></dependency><dependency> <groupId>org.hibernate</gr
2017-03-30 10:03:26
13013
原创 CCF JAVA 画图 20140902
题目:在一个定义了直角坐标系的纸上,画一个(x1,y1)到(x2,y2)的矩形指将横坐标范围从x1到x2,纵坐标范围从y1到y2之间的区域涂上颜色。 下图给出了一个画了两个矩形的例子。第一个矩形是(1,1) 到(4, 4),用绿色和紫色表示。第二个矩形是(2, 3)到(6, 5),用蓝色和紫色表示。图中,一共有15个单位的面积被涂上颜色,其中紫色部分被涂了两次,但在计算面积时只计算一次。在实
2017-03-09 10:50:37
632
原创 Android TextView实现跑马灯效果
<TextView android:text="@string/hello" android:ellipsize="marquee" android:focusable="true" android:focusableInTouchMode="true" android:layout_width="match_paren
2016-10-20 17:45:44
286
原创 完美解决Hibernate与MySQL中文乱码问题
MySQL端的配置在MySQL解压根目录下,修改my.ini文件(如果没有my.ini文件则修改my-default.ini文件)在文件中添加 default-character-set = utf8然后在控制台中新建数据库是后面跟上 charset utf8 , 例如: create database hibernate charset utf8;新建表时也相应跟上 charset ut
2016-04-24 21:56:15
869
原创 在Dynamic Web Project中新建jsp报错
新建jsp页面报错提示:The superclass “javax.servlet.http.HttpServlet” was not found on the Java Build Path解决方法: 在你的web工程名上右击—>build Path—>Confiure build pathlibraries—>add library—>Server Runtime—>Tomcat
2016-04-07 21:35:16
548
原创 OSGi Manifest元文件
1.可读信息Bundle-Name : bundle的一个缩写名Bundle-Description : 用于更详细的描述bundle的功能Bundle-DocURL : 可以提供更多有关bundle的文档的URLBundle-Category : 一组用逗号分隔的分类名,OSGI并没有指定,你可以自由指定Bundle-Vendor : Bundle-ContactAddress :
2016-04-06 20:14:48
410
原创 Struts2 Action访问Servlet API
Struts2提供了ActionContext类来访问ServletAPIActionContext中常用的方法 Object get(Object key):类似于调用HttpServletRequest的getAttribute(String name)方法Map getApplication(): 模拟了该应用的ServletContext实例static ActionContext
2016-04-06 18:22:26
430
原创 Maven入门 第一章
1.1Maven的安装与配置下载Maven在官网根据需要下载相应版本:Maven官网安装Mavenzip文件直接解压就可以,例如:F:\apache-maven-3.3.9配置Maven工作环境在环境变量中添加: M2_HOME : F:\apache-maven-3.3.9在环境变量PATH中追加: F:\apache-maven-3.3.9\bin测试Maven是否安装成功请在网
2016-04-06 15:52:23
316
原创 第一章:MySql数据库入门
MySql 入门MySql的启动1. 已管理员模式启动命令行.2. 输入命令: net start mysql --->此处会显示成功启动服务3. 登录命令: mysql -u root -p --->此处会提示输入密码4. 输入你的密码.
2016-04-05 20:58:02
496
转载 MySql 修改root用户密码的方式
1、打开终端win+r输入cmd回车即可打开;2、修改MySQL的root用户密码格式:mysqladmin -u用户名 -p旧密码 password 新密码例子:mysqladmin -uroot -pamgji password 123456上面例子将用户root原来的密码amgji改为新密码123456重新登录,输入新密码123456就ok了;
2016-04-05 16:51:33
359
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人